Key challenges rema<strong>in</strong>, however, not least the ongo<strong>in</strong>g impact of the crisis. Governments<br />
have been under pressure to carry out cost-sav<strong>in</strong>g reforms <strong>in</strong> the context of austerity, with<strong>in</strong><br />
the context of a need to respond to demographic developments. Trade unions and sometimes<br />
employers’ organisations have <strong>in</strong> many cases been opposed to government plans, and have on<br />
occasion managed to <strong>in</strong>fluence policy, but the sheer speed of events and the need to push<br />
through reforms immediately has meant that the <strong>in</strong>fluence of the social partners sometimes<br />
has been limited.<br />
All of these developments represent significant challenges for the social partners.<br />
Governments are clearly under pressure to f<strong>in</strong>d solutions to, on the one hand the very acute<br />
challenges posed by the crisis, and on the other hand the longer-term challenges posed by<br />
demographic and economic shifts. Seek<strong>in</strong>g consensus with stakeholders such as the social<br />
partners is one way of achiev<strong>in</strong>g this. Nevertheless, the social partners will need to develop<br />
strategies to ensure that they rema<strong>in</strong> at the negotiat<strong>in</strong>g table when governments are<br />
formulat<strong>in</strong>g rapid responses to the crisis. The development of second- and third-pillar pension<br />
provision represents a real opportunity for the social partners to become major stakeholders <strong>in</strong><br />
reform. However, they need to carve out a longer-term strategy <strong>in</strong> response to this, <strong>in</strong> order to<br />
ensure their position as players <strong>in</strong> the development of this k<strong>in</strong>d of provision, rather than<br />
rely<strong>in</strong>g simply on state regulation.<br />
Chapter 7 - <strong>Europe</strong>an social dialogue developments 2010 – <strong>2012</strong><br />
The social dialogue structures at the <strong>Europe</strong>an level rema<strong>in</strong> an important forum for<br />
discussions and negotiations between the social partners at cross-<strong>in</strong>dustry as well as sectoral<br />
social level across the EU. Dur<strong>in</strong>g the past two years the representatives of management and<br />
labour have agreed on more than 70 jo<strong>in</strong>t texts, conducted numerous projects and started to<br />
cooperate <strong>in</strong> new economic sectors. Overall, <strong>2012</strong> saw a significant number of agreements<br />
signed by the social partners. Two of these, establish<strong>in</strong>g m<strong>in</strong>imum standards <strong>in</strong> <strong>in</strong>land<br />
waterways transport, and hairdress<strong>in</strong>g, were requested by the social partners to be<br />
implemented through EU legislation under article 155.2 of the TFEU, and the same request is<br />
expected from the social partners of the sea fisheries sector once their agreement is f<strong>in</strong>alised.<br />
These requests, particularly concern<strong>in</strong>g the agreement <strong>in</strong> the hairdress<strong>in</strong>g sector, became the<br />
subject of some media attention and political debate <strong>in</strong> <strong>2012</strong>. For its part the <strong>Commission</strong> is<br />
assess<strong>in</strong>g both agreements impartially and has not taken a decision on whether or not to<br />
propose their legislative implementation. By contrast, a new agreement <strong>in</strong> the professional<br />
football sector will be implemented autonomously by the social partners accord<strong>in</strong>g to the<br />
procedures and practices specific to management and labour and the Member States.<br />
